Transaction 95e00889046f370f592a225eabcaf68cdaeda1cff5265ccca1876a5fbc7edcf6

4 Input
2 Outputs
  • 95e00889046f370f592a225eabcaf68cdaeda1cff5265ccca1876a5fbc7edcf6:0
  • value  2482645
    address  34ycvSiudXCDaRmbX5pCuR3KE1YL6HXSSM
  • 95e00889046f370f592a225eabcaf68cdaeda1cff5265ccca1876a5fbc7edcf6:1
  • value  12000000
    address  1P5vB74WUFL1sYCoYk9FT5a5Jzd6zvkjdZ